Key Risks
- Total loss: long option positions can expire worthless, resulting in loss of the entire premium paid.
- Unlimited loss: short (naked) call positions carry theoretically unlimited loss potential;
short puts can lose many times the premium received.
- Assignment & exercise risk: short options may be assigned at any time before expiration
(early assignment is common around ex-dividend dates), potentially creating stock positions and margin calls.
- Multi-leg complexity: spreads and combinations may be filled partially or at prices
materially different from quoted mid-points; legging risk applies.
- Liquidity risk: wide bid/ask spreads and low volume can prevent exiting positions at acceptable prices.
- Volatility & time decay: implied volatility changes and theta decay can move option
prices against you even when the underlying does not move.
- Model risk: analytics shown in GreeksView (GEX, IV rank, theoretical P/L, probability
estimates) rely on mathematical models and assumptions that may be wrong, delayed, or based on incomplete data.
- Technology risk: data delays, API outages, browser issues, or connectivity problems may
prevent order placement or cancellation when you need it most.
